14874-82-9 Usage
Description
Dicarbonylacetylacetonato rhodium(I), also known as (acetylacetonato)dicarbonylrhodium(I), is a red/green crystalline powder with significant applications in various chemical reactions and molecular engineering processes. It is a versatile catalyst that plays a crucial role in the synthesis of complex organic molecules and materials.
Uses
Used in Molecular Engineering:
Dicarbonylacetylacetonato rhodium(I) is used as a catalyst for in situ formation of a fluorous-soluble hydroformylation catalyst, which is of great interest in molecular engineering. This application allows for the efficient and selective synthesis of various organic compounds with potential applications in p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and other industries.
Used in Carbonylation Reactions:
Dicarbonylacetylacetonato rhodium(I) is employed as a catalyst for various carbonylation reactions, which involve the introduction of a carbonyl group (C=O) into a molecule. These reactions are essential in the synthesis of a wide range of organic compounds, including pharmaceuticals, dyes, and polymers.
Used in Silylcarbocyclizations:
This rhodium complex is used as a catalyst in silylcarbocyclizations, which are reactions that involve the formation of a cyclic compound through the addition of a silyl group to a carbon-carbon double bond. These reactions are important in the synthesis of complex organic molecules, such as natural products and pharmaceuticals.
Used in Conjugate Additions to Enones:
Dicarbonylacetylacetonato rhodium(I) is used as a catalyst for conjugate additions to enones, which are reactions that involve the addition of a nucleophile to the β-carbon of an enone, forming a new carbon-carbon bond. This type of reaction is widely used in the synthesis of various organic compounds, including pharmaceuticals and natural products.
Used in Carbamoylstannation:
This rhodium complex is used as a catalyst in carbamoylstannation reactions, which involve the formation of a carbon-nitrogen bond through the addition of a stannane reagent to an isocyanate. These reactions are important in the synthesis of various organic compounds, including p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als.
Used in Reduction of Aromatic Nitro Compounds:
Dicarbonylacetylacetonato rhodium(I) is used as a catalyst for the reduction of aromatic nitro compounds to anilines, which are important intermediates in the synthesis of dyes, pharmaceuticals, and other organic compounds.
Used in Hydroformylation Reaction:
This rhodium complex is employed as a catalyst in hydroformylation reactions, which involve the addition of a formyl group (CHO) to an alkene, forming an aldehyde. Hydroformylation is an important industrial process for the production of aldehydes, which are used as building blocks for various chemicals, including plastics, solvents, and pharmaceuticals.
Reaction
Precatalyst for hydroformylation of olefins.
Precatalyst for silylformylation of olefins.
Precatalyst for carbonylative silylcarbo-cyclization in the syntheses of isodomoic acids.
Precatalyst for the conjugate addition of aryl- and alkenylboronic acids to enones.
